Valley Oaks Health is proud to announce its designation as the Community Mental Health Center (CMHC) for Clinton County, marking a significant step forward in expanding access to high-quality, community-based behavioral health care for residents throughout the region.
This designation represents a collaborative transition between Valley Oaks Health, Community Health Network, and Clinton County Government. Together, the organizations are working closely to ensure a seamless transition of care for current behavioral health patients who wish to change providers, while also building long-term solutions that increase local access to safety net mental health and addiction treatment services.

The transition includes:
- Smooth continuity of care for existing patients currently served by Community Health Network who wish to transition to Valley Oaks Health.
- Strong local partnerships with primary care providers, schools, law enforcement, and other community agencies
- Expanded behavioral health services including community-based and outpatient services, psychiatric care, substance use treatment, and crisis support
Valley Oaks Health has already engaged with Clinton County residents, leaders, and organizations to identify local priorities, reduce barriers to care, and build a behavioral health system that reflects the strengths and values of the community.
